How do I remove the underpayment penalty if there is no way to edit the revisit page in Additional Tax Payments?

How do I remove the underpayment penalty if there is no way to edit the revisit page in Additional Tax Payments? I use the program as a tax preparer, not a tax collector. I will not go through with the filing if I cannot edit the penalty to 0. Please help if you can.

You may be able to reduce or eliminate your underpayment penalty by annualizing your tax. To do this:

  1. Launch TurboTax and search for annualizing your tax in t. box with the magnifying glass
  2. Select Jump to annualizing your tax
  3. TurboTax will ask you a series of questions which may reduce or eliminate your underpayment penalty.

If you want to zero the penalty you would have to override that line and file on paper.

 

The Online TurboTax does not allow overrides.

To go through the penalty calculation:

  1. Other tax situations
  2. Scroll to Additional Tax Payments.
  3. Select Underpayment penalties.
  4. The first screen says You chose to let the IRS bill you later.
  5. Select Continue
  6. The penalty will not appear on the 1040.
